In heavy industries such as steel, cement, mining, construction, and manufacturing, equipment operates under relentless stress. Crushers absorb impact forces. Rolling mills face continuous high loads. Hydraulic systems handle pressure spikes. Gearboxes endure vibration and torque fluctuations.
In such shock-intensive environments, lubrication is not just maintenance- it is protection. When lubrication fails, the consequences are immediate: overheating, surface fatigue, metal-to-metal contact, and ultimately catastrophic breakdowns.

The Problem: Why High-Load and Shock Applications Destroy Conventional Lubricants
High-load operations create extreme pressure between contact surfaces. Shock loads further amplify stress during sudden impacts or rapid load shifts.
Common lubrication challenges include:
- Film breakdown under extreme pressure
- Oxidation and thermal degradation
- Shear instability in high-speed gear systems
- Grease washout in wet environments
- Hydraulic oil foaming under pressure spikes
Standard mineral oils or low-grade greases often lose viscosity, thin out, or degrade quickly. This leads to:
- Increased friction and heat
- Surface pitting and scuffing
- Reduced component life
- Higher maintenance frequency
- Unplanned downtime
To maintain consistent performance, heavy-duty operations require engineered lubrication solutions.
